Discuss how to handle a detail involving a large group of partying teenagers. First, discuss locker-room truisms, rules of thumb, that you have heard about how to do such a job. Second, critique these rules of thumb and consider alternative ways to do the job. Note that the reason for having this discussion is to emphasize the idea there is more than one way to handle any type of detail-there are, in common vernacular, "many ways to skin a cat."
Synergistic Effect
The combined effect of two or more variables that exceeds the sum of their individual effects.
Alcohol
A psychoactive substance commonly found in beverages like beer, wine, and spirits, which can have intoxicating effects.
Esophageal
Pertaining to the esophagus, which is the muscular tube that connects the throat (pharynx) with the stomach.
Endometrial
Pertaining to or involving the endometrium, which is the mucous membrane lining the uterus.
